Celtic's red-hot striker Odsonne Edouard is being tracked by European heavyweights Napoli and Borussia Dortmund, according to a report.

The Frenchman is in scintillating form and has been named Premiership player of the month for August.

Outwith his domestic form where he's notched six goals in 12 games so far, Edouard has stormed onto the international stage with four goals in two games for France under-21s.

And this has forced clubs around Europe to sit up and take notice, with Daily Mail claiming Carlo Ancelotti's Napoli keeping a close eye on the striker.

Dortmund and AS Monaco have both also been credited with an interest in the 21-year-old but the Italian giants are believed to be seriously considering a move that could be worth around £30million.

Of course, the transfer window is currently closed, but it has been reported that Napoli could make a move next summer.

Edouard signed for Celts in 2018 for £9million after a successful loan spell from PSG.
